Book excerpt: Go badass or go home... Bookish good girl Ann Leahey wants only one thing-to live a nice quiet life in her hometown of River Falls, Montana. But her elderly boss thinks it's high time Ann starts living large and issues her a challenge-being daring or she will sell out to the land developer bent on bringing a big box store to River Falls. What's a woman to do but put on a short skirt and hit the Rusty Rail Saloon to save her town? The last thing on Mitchell Black's mind is an adventuresome sex-capade, especially with a preacher's daughter who's trying too hard to be a badass. He's got two younger brothers to raise and a ranch to run. But one look at Ann and he's rethinking his priorities. Problem is, will Ann's newfound badassery have her hankering to leave Montana for good?
